Why it's worth checking out

The Willoughby District Historical Society sits on Johnson Street in Chatswood, a major hub on Sydney's Lower North Shore. A 4.6 rating from 19 reviews marks it as a well-regarded cultural spot.

The appeal is a genuine slice of local history — a historical society preserving and sharing the story of the Willoughby district, a fascinating and enriching stop for anyone interested in the area's past, in the handy Chatswood area. Its location makes it a rewarding cultural stop.

Collections, programs and opening hours change over time, and historical societies often keep limited hours. To make the most of your visit, it's worth checking the current opening details directly before you go.
